Section 35706.5 Of Article 1. Reorganization Of School Districts By The Electorate From California Education Code >> Division 3. >> Title 2. >> Part 21. >> Chapter 4. >> Article 1.
35706.5
. (a) No action to reorganize the boundaries of a school
district shall be initiated or completed without the consent of a
majority of all of the members of the governing board of the school
district if both of the following conditions apply to the school
district:
(1) It has obtained an emergency apportionment loan from the State
of California, but the Superintendent of Public Instruction has
determined that a state administrator is no longer necessary, and has
restored, prior to the effective date of this section, the legal
rights, duties, and powers of the governing board of the district
pursuant to Section 41326.
(2) It has a student population 70 percent of which is from either
a "lower income household" or "very low income household" as those
terms are defined in Sections 50079.5 and 50105, respectively, of the
Health and Safety Code.
(b) For purposes of this section, for any school district that
meets the description specified in paragraph (1), consent to an
action to reorganize the boundaries of the school district shall no
longer be required when 10 years have elapsed from the date of final
payment by the school district of the emergency loan to the State of
California.
